Howe Utility Pliers - Angled 12.5 cm (3 mm Beak)

The Howe Utility Pliers are a universal orthodontic chairside pliers used for placing and removing archwires, tucking ligature ends, and handling general small wire work. The long slim beaks have fine cross-serrations that grip round and rectangular archwires without slipping, while the thin tapered profile keeps the operator's line of sight clear of the bracket being worked on. This version has an angled head and a 3 mm-diameter beak, which is well suited to fine light-wire manipulation and tight interproximal access. The pliers use a rivet-joint pivot with hardened stainless-steel beaks. Equate Instruments supplies them non-sterile, passivated, ultrasonically cleaned, individually packed, and fully autoclavable for routine in-clinic sterilisation.

Ball Hook Crimping Plier

The Ball Hook Crimping Plier is an orthodontic utility plier designed to crimp ball hooks, stops and auxiliary hooks onto archwires at the chairside. A profiled indentation on the upper beak matches the geometry of a standard ball hook, while the opposing beak supports the hook body, so a single controlled pinch closes the crimpable sleeve around the wire without deforming the hook. Long curved stainless-steel handles taper outward for a pen-style grip and deliver the consistent closing force needed for reliable crimping. The plier is autoclavable and supplied non-sterile. From Equate Instruments, it is the go-to tool for clinicians adding crimpable hooks for elastics, power chains and auxiliary mechanics.

Hammerhead Distal End Bending Pliers - 9mm Jaw, 0.46mm / .018in Wire

The Hammerhead Distal End Bending Pliers are orthodontic wire-handling pliers designed to safely tuck the cut distal end of an archwire behind the buccal tube, preventing soft-tissue irritation in the cheek and vestibule. The 9 mm hammerhead jaw bends wire up to 0.46 mm (.018 in) with a controlled crimp that holds the wire end against the band without repeated re-bending. Manufactured from surgical stainless steel by Equate Instruments, the pliers feature slim sprung handles contoured for single-hand operation and a precise pivot with minimal backlash. The polished finish resists corrosion through repeat autoclave cycles, making the instrument a routine chairside tool for orthodontists and orthodontic assistants.

Three-Jaw Pliers Rounded 12.5cm

The three-jaw pliers are wire-bending pliers with a two-prong jaw opposed by a single central prong, forming a precise three-point contact that grips round wire at three locations for symmetrical bending. The rounded prong tips are polished to avoid nicking the wire, so the bend stays smooth along its length and the archwire retains its surface finish. A box joint holds the jaws in accurate alignment under load, and the 12.5 cm handles balance comfortably for both hands. Equate Instruments supplies the pliers forged in passivated stainless steel with a cutting capacity up to 0.036 inch (0.76 mm) wire, fully autoclavable and supplied non-sterile in individual packaging.

Young Pliers - Box Joint 13.5 cm

The Young Pliers in a box-joint 13.5 cm pattern are a universal orthodontic wire-forming instrument for labial arches and multi-size loops. A stepped pyramid beak opposite a flat beak allows the operator to bend loops of varying diameter simply by moving the wire along the step, making the plier a single-tool answer for many contour adjustments in removable appliances. The precision box joint from Equate Instruments keeps the beaks in rigid alignment under forming force, so repeat bends land at consistent positions on the step. Hardened edges also allow cutting of hard wires up to 0.028 inch, and the passivated stainless-steel body is fully autoclavable and supplied non-sterile for in-office processing.
